    EP5000

    I don't have a manual to send you, but I can tell you that code has to do with the large capacity tray's failure to open after the button on the front has been pressed. There is a solenoid in the back that releases to open the drawer. If the drawer is opening and still getting the code the sensor near the solenoid is likely dirty.
